Key Buying Factors for Golf Cart Battery Chargers for Lithium Batteries
Voltage and Battery Chemistry
Confirm your battery’s nominal voltage and charge profile before buying. Most lithium golf cart setups use 48V systems with a 51.2V lithium pack and a full-charge target around 58.4V. The charger must be designed for LiFePO4 or the specific chemistry your battery requires.
Charging Speed
Amperage affects how quickly the battery recovers after a round of golf or a long drive. A 15A charger is a solid all-around choice, while 18A models can shorten downtime if you charge frequently or use the cart heavily. Faster is not always better if your battery maker recommends a lower charge rate.
Connector and Cart Compatibility
Match the connector style to your cart, battery, and charging port. Some chargers are built for Club Car, EZGO TXT/RXV, or ring-terminal installations, while others use D-plugs or other interfaces. A charger can be excellent and still be the wrong fit if the plug is off by even one detail.
Protection and Convenience Features
Look for smart charging logic, overheat and overvoltage protection, and waterproof construction if the charger will be used in damp environments. Wake-up capability can also help with deeply discharged lithium batteries, while clear indicator lights make charging status easier to read.
Who Should Buy Which Golf Cart Battery Chargers for Lithium Batteries?
If you want the fastest practical top-off, choose a higher-amp model. If your priority is plug-and-play convenience, buy the charger that matches your cart’s exact connector and voltage profile. If you store your charger in a garage, shed, or on the cart, waterproof and rugged models are the safest long-term pick. For owners comparing Golf Cart Battery Chargers for Lithium Batteries for mixed-use vehicles, choose a smart charger that supports the correct chemistry and offers broad compatibility without sacrificing safety.
